    Judy Wong

    Long serving (1969-1987) office manager for Fleetwood Mac. Judy was responsible for introducing Bob Welch to the band. She is the subject of Danny Kirwan's song "Jewel Eyed Judy". Fleetwood Mac's album Tango In The Night is dedicated to her. Judy attended the University of California, Berkeley, and was the owner and clothing designer of Passionflower, a fashion boutique in North Beach in San Francisco. Her roommates in San Francisco were the twins, Jenny and [url=https://www.discogs.com/artist/1401442]Patti Boyd[/url]. Judy Wong is one of the former wifes of Glenn Cornick (of Jethro Tull), whom she married March 7, 1970 but divorced in 1971. Her death date is uncertain because she lived and died alone and was only found some time later.

    b.: Sept. 16, 1943 in Los Angeles, CA
    d.: March 2005 in Los Angeles, CA
